§ 2991. Creation and use of proxies in residential health care and\nmental hygiene facilities.

1.Residential health care facilities and\nmental hygiene facilities shall establish procedures:\n (a) to provide information to adult residents about their right to\ncreate a health care proxy under this article;\n (b) to educate adult residents about the authority delegated under a\nhealth care proxy, what a proxy may include or omit, and how a proxy is\ncreated and revoked;\n (c) to help ensure that each resident who creates a proxy while\nresiding at the facility does so voluntarily.\n 2.
